Inter left-back Robin Gosens will not be part of Germany’s squad for the World Cup, according to Kicker.
Per the report, Germany coach Hansi Flick has opted for Freiburg captain Christian Günter instead.

RB Leipzig defender Lukas Klostermann will also travel to Qatar, having recently returned to team training after a long injury spell. Borussia Dortmund’s Karim Adeyemi is in the squad too.

Earlier today, Sport1 reported that Borussia Dortmund wonderkid Youssoufa Moukoko will earn his first senior call-up.

Marco Reus, on the other hand, will miss out through injury, per several reports.
